Photon08 commited on
Commit
fb8c0b6
·
1 Parent(s): 8508782

Update app.py

Browse files

Added pdf module

Files changed (1) hide show
  1. app.py +8 -1
app.py CHANGED
@@ -5,6 +5,7 @@ import librosa
5
  import streamlit as st
6
  import numpy as np
7
  from fpdf import FPDF
 
8
 
9
 
10
 
@@ -55,8 +56,14 @@ if st.button("Generate"):
55
  pdf.add_page()
56
 
57
  pdf.set_font("Arial", size = 15)
58
-
 
59
  for words in transcription:
60
  pdf.cell(200, 10, txt = x, ln = 1, align = 'L')
61
  output = pdf.output("transcript.pdf")
62
  st.download(label="Click here to download the transcript", data=output, mime='pdf',file_name="transcript.pdf")
 
 
 
 
 
 
5
  import streamlit as st
6
  import numpy as np
7
  from fpdf import FPDF
8
+ from reportlab.pdfgen.canvas import Canvas
9
 
10
 
11
 
 
56
  pdf.add_page()
57
 
58
  pdf.set_font("Arial", size = 15)
59
+
60
+ '''
61
  for words in transcription:
62
  pdf.cell(200, 10, txt = x, ln = 1, align = 'L')
63
  output = pdf.output("transcript.pdf")
64
  st.download(label="Click here to download the transcript", data=output, mime='pdf',file_name="transcript.pdf")
65
+ '''
66
+ canvas = Canvas("transcript.pdf")
67
+ canvas.drawString(72, 72, transcription)
68
+ canvas.save()
69
+ st.download(label="Click here to download the transcript", data=canvas, mime='pdf',file_name="transcript.pdf")